My husband wanted to get some sort of stucco design on some concrete block walls on the front of our property. But he left the final design pattern up to me.
So, we met Bomery (spelling?) who was canvassing our block with flyers for BuildPros Construction (BPC) and the timing was truly auspicious. My husband told him what we were looking for, and the very next day Project Manager, Dusan (Dule) Dimitrijevic stopped by our home to take measurements for the project.

Eventually we signed the contract. Remeasurements were taken the very next day (standard for this company), and a day later the work crew came by to begin the project. I decided on a stucco pattern called Spanish (texture), and Manuel (Manny), Rudy, and Willie - the hardworking, extremely polite, and wonderful work crew - laid the very first few layers of stucco down. They actually did 3 layers because the concrete block walls seams showed through, versus using only one layer. They needed to do this to create a seamless effect.

Forty eight hours passed and Manny and his guys came by earlier today to add the final layer of stucco. Originally, I wanted the Spanish style, but decided on the next level up called, Spanish Lace. Now, am guessing that Manny and his guys might call it a Knockdown Wall Texture type in their lingo, but I prefer to call it Spanish Lace.

By the by, it turned out gorgeous! We're getting our home's exterior painted and I will have to decide on a color to paint the newly stucco walls. But as you will see in the 2 photos I am providing, they are bare in color, which will be added when the house gets painted. And before the paint job commences, we will need to add cap stones to finish the top of the walls.

And while our newly textured walls are currently drying, let me say that both my husband and I are very impressed with the final results! Kudos to Manuel and the amazing crew, and their clean-up was exceptional. And a second kudo to Dule (Project Manager) for his integrity, patience, kindness, and outstanding customer service.
